Output 264d7a4be17ef66205cc0ea199c0e0c5f297d17ba64eb1df7e58b4c26e7972c6:0

value
1779613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ad0deef2831734cafb83dd341a76d839ae5f253c OP_EQUAL
address
3HU3WqdGFfqBnXT7uvVuCUMBB9zNE9gK4Y
transaction
264d7a4be17ef66205cc0ea199c0e0c5f297d17ba64eb1df7e58b4c26e7972c6
spent
true